Data Engineering for AI Implementation
This professional certificate program is designed for data professionals who want to implement AI solutions.
Learn how to design, build, and deploy scalable data engineering systems that support AI applications.
Data Engineering is a critical component of AI implementation, enabling organizations to collect, process, and analyze large datasets. This program covers data warehousing, ETL, big data processing, and cloud-based data engineering.
Gain hands-on experience with tools like Apache Spark, Hadoop, and NoSQL databases. Develop skills in data modeling, data governance, and data quality.
AI Implementation requires a solid understanding of data engineering principles. This program prepares you to work with AI teams, design data pipelines, and ensure data quality.
